Concrete sidewalk repair services involve fixing damaged or deteriorating sections of a property’s walkway. Over time, exposure to weather, foot traffic, and ground shifting can cause cracks, uneven surfaces, and other issues that compromise the safety and appearance of a sidewalk. Skilled contractors can remove damaged concrete, prepare the area, and pour new, durable concrete to restore a smooth, level surface. This process helps improve the safety of walkways, making them safer for residents, visitors, and anyone using the property.
Many common sidewalk problems are caused by cracks, heaving, or uneven sections that develop over years. Cracks can pose tripping hazards, especially for children, seniors, or individuals with mobility challenges. Heaving or sinking sections can create uneven surfaces that increase the risk of falls or make it difficult to use wheelchairs, strollers, or other mobility aids. Repairing these issues promptly not only enhances safety but also prevents further damage that could lead to more extensive and costly rep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Sidewalk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Tulare County,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or crack filling or patching range from $250-$600 for many routine jobs. These projects usually involve localized repairs and are common in residential sidewalks. Larger or more extensive repairs can push costs higher but remain within a moderate range.
Medium-Scale Repairs - for more significant surface leveling or crack sealing, local contractors often charge between $600-$1,500. Many projects fall into this band, especially when addressing multiple cracks or small sections of sidewalk needing attention.
Large Repairs or Resurfacing - projects involving surface replacement, leveling, or extensive patchwork typically cost between $1,500-$3,500. These are common for older sidewalks with widespread damage that require more comprehensive work.
Full Replacement - complete sidewalk replacement can range from $3,500 to over $5,000 depending on size and complexity. While fewer projects fall into this highest tier, local service providers can handle these larger jobs for properties needing a full overhaul.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What signs indicate that a concrete sidewalk needs repair? Cracks, uneven surfaces, and spalling are common indicators that a sidewalk may require professional repair services.
Are there different types of sidewalk repair options available? Yes, options can include crack filling, patching, leveling, or complete replacement, depending on the extent of damage.
How can local contractors improve the safety of a damaged sidewalk? They can repair cracks, eliminate trip hazards, and restore a smooth, level surface to prevent accidents.
What causes concrete sidewalks to deteriorate over time? Factors such as exposure to weather, ground movement, and regular wear can contribute to sidewalk deterioration.
How do professionals typically prepare a sidewalk before repair work begins? They assess the damage, clean the area, and remove loose or damaged concrete to ensure proper adhesion of repair materials.
